This audiobook is narrated by Vanessa Edwin and Shane East.
Dual POV 

Tropes: 
Single parents/neighbors
Dual POV
Both over 35 (refreshing) 
FMC carpenter / MMC vet

English man are definitely my kind of man. I loved the witty banter and sarcasm between January and Liam. 😂
I also love the feminist statements underneath the story. You don’t have to do something for someone else if you really don’t want to for yourself first.
It is a fun, lighthearted, sweet romcom. A bit repetitive and with not a deep plot.
So you are having a bad day, that’s a good reading possibility.
